DFHBI
DFHBI is a small molecule that resembles the chromophore of green fluorescent protein (GFP) . DFHBI can be used for imaging RNA in living cells. . Spinach and DFHBI are essentially nonfluorescent when unbound, whereas the Spinach-DFHBI complex is brightly fluorescent both in vitro and in living cells (Ex/Em = 469/501 nm) .
